Galesha finished Dordogne
Dordogne was such a sweet and cozy experience that made me really excited for the upcoming (and maybe already ongoing) summer. in the game you follow Mimi, as she returns to her grandmother's house years after something happened there. she has no memories of the place, but as you progress through the game, Mimi remembers more and more of her summer in Dordogne. like I said, this game just had very lovely vibes and I enjoyed the watercolor environments of the game. the gameplay was laid back, and wasn't anything special but what mattered more to me was the aesthetic of the game. I'm also very close to both of my grandmothers so it made me think of past summers I've spent at their houses and cottages ~

Galesha finished Submerged
Submerged is a cozy, but yet emotional game about a sister, who is forced to loot for items in a city submerged in water to save her brother. as you scavenge and scale buildings, you learn more about the city and its inhabitants and what happened to your family. I found the atmosphere of this game to be perfect and I enjoyed my time with the game, but the janky and repetitive gameplay (to complete the game, you have to retrieve items from 10 different buildings) occasionally combined with kind of ugly graphics hindered the experience. the gameplay really reminded me of Jusant, although it's nowhere near as polished, but I still enjoyed exploring the sunken city and just driving my boat all over. the music is beautiful and it combined with the slight eeriness of the empty city made the game quite enjoyable. if you liked Jusant, you probably like this game as well ~
